# Function to read entries from the configuration file
|
|
read_entries() {
|
|
if [[ -f $CONFIG_FILE ]]; then
|
|
HOSTS_ENTRIES=() # Initialize an empty array to store host entries
|
|
while IFS= read -r line; do # Read each line from the configuration file
|
|
[[ $line =~ ^#.*$ || -z $line ]] && continue # Skip comments and empty lines
|
|
if [[ $line == $DEFAULT_RESOLVER* ]]; then
|
|
HOSTS_ENTRIES+=("$line") # If line starts with the default resolver, add it directly
|
|
domain=$(echo "$line" | awk '{print $2}') # Extract the domain name
|
|
else
|
|
HOSTS_ENTRIES+=("$DEFAULT_RESOLVER $line") # Prepend the default resolver
|
|
domain=$line # Set the domain to the current line
|
|
fi
|
|
# Add www. prefix if not already present
|
|
if [[ $domain != www.* && $domain != $DEFAULT_RESOLVER* ]]; then
|
|
HOSTS_ENTRIES+=("$DEFAULT_RESOLVER www.$domain")
|
|
fi
|
|
done < "$CONFIG_FILE"
|
|
else
|
|
echo "Configuration file $CONFIG_FILE not found."
|
|
exit 1
|
|
fi
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
# Function to create a backup of the hosts file
|
|
backup_hosts_file() {
|
|
BACKUP_FILE="$BACKUP_DIR/hosts_backup_$(date +%s)" # Set the backup file name with a timestamp
|
|
sudo cp "$HOSTS_FILE" "$BACKUP_FILE" # Copy the current hosts file to the backup location
|
|
echo "Backup of hosts file created at $BACKUP_FILE" # Inform the user about the backup location
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
# Function to add entries to /etc/hosts
|
|
add_entries() {
|
|
{
|
|
echo "$START_MARKER" # Add the start marker
|
|
for entry in "${HOSTS_ENTRIES[@]}"; do # Iterate over each entry
|
|
echo "$entry" # Add each entry
|
|
done
|
|
echo "$END_MARKER" # Add the end marker
|
|
} | sudo tee -a "$HOSTS_FILE" > /dev/null # Append entries to the hosts file
|
|
echo "Entries added." # Inform the user that entries have been added
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
# Function to remove entries from /etc/hosts
|
|
remove_entries() {
|
|
sudo sed -i.bak "/$START_MARKER/,/$END_MARKER/d" "$HOSTS_FILE" # Remove entries between the markers
|
|
echo "Entries removed." # Inform the user that entries have been removed
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
# Function to toggle entries in /etc/hosts
|
|
toggle_entries() {
|
|
if grep -q "$START_MARKER" "$HOSTS_FILE"; then
|
|
remove_entries # If entries are present, remove them
|
|
else
|
|
backup_hosts_file # Create a backup before adding entries
|
|
add_entries # Add entries to the hosts file
|
|
fi
|
|
}
